The RPI-122A is a silicon phototransistor manufactured by Rohm Semiconductor. This device is designed to detect infrared light and is commonly used in various applications, including remote control systems, optical sensors, and light barriers. It converts incident infrared light into an electrical signal.
Applications
- Remote control receivers
- Optical switches
- Light curtains
- Object detection sensors
- Encoders
Features
- High sensitivity to infrared light
- Fast response time
- Compact package size
- Operating Wavelength: 940 nm
- Collector-Emitter Voltage (VCEO): 30 V
- Collector Current (IC): 20 mA
- Wide receiving angle
